Citi Appointed Depositary Bank for The Weir Group’s ADR Programme

LONDON–(BUSINESS WIRE)–Citi, acting through Citibank N.A., has been appointed by The Weir Group PLC (“Weir”), one of the world’s leading engineering businesses to the minerals, oil and gas industry, as depositary bank for its Level 1 American Depositary Receipt (ADR) programme, which trades on the US over-the-counter (OTC) marketplace under the symbol “WEGRY”. Each ordinary share represents 2 ADRs. Weir’s underlying ordinary shares are listed and trade on the London Stock Exchange under symbol “WEIR”.

About Weir

Founded in 1871, The Weir Group PLC is based in Glasgow, Scotland and is one of the world’s leading engineering businesses. Weir designs, manufactures and services innovative solutions which make minerals, oil and gas and power customers more efficient. This is recognised in the global leadership positions it has developed in its core markets. The Group aims to be a partner of choice to our customers with a worldwide network of around 200 manufacturing facilities and service centres. The business has a presence in more than 70 countries, with over 14,000 people. www.global.weir/

About Citi

Citi, the leading global bank, has approximately 200 million customer accounts and does business in more than 160 countries and jurisdictions. Citi provides consumers, corporations, governments and institutions with a broad range of financial products and services, including consumer banking and credit, corporate and investment banking, securities brokerage, transaction services, and wealth management.
